What is Bubba's Seafood House?
Established in 1997, Bubba's Seafood House & Oyster Bar has evolved into a premier destination for seafood enthusiasts in the Gulf Coast region. The company distinguishes itself through a unique blend of high-volume, family-oriented service and a festive, vibrant atmosphere. Its market position is anchored by a diverse menu featuring fresh shrimp, crabs, and oysters, complemented by amenities such as large-format seating and child-centric entertainment areas like its signature sandbox. Beyond its culinary offerings, the restaurant serves as a community hub, hosting significant cultural events such as Mardi Gras celebrations.
